Business Valuation Specialists

Parmentier Arthur is a specialist in valuing businesses and shares in unquoted companies. We also value intellectual property such as patent rights and trademarks. Our experience covers most industries and all situations when a value has to be placed on a minority shareholding or a whole company or business.
